Since most users are on single-user PC's Puppy Linux doesn't bother
with sub-accounts by default, you are automatically Root.
It is not a big deal to change that but rarely is necessary - and yes,
it does generally prompt for Yes/No when you attempt a significant
action that on other distros would require a special login as Root.
Have used Debian, Stormix, RedHat, SuSE, and a bunch of others in
the past, prefer Puppy.
